How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Town Of Tonawanda?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Town Of Tonawanda Studio Apartments | $1,126 | $890 | $2,009 |
Town Of Tonawanda 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,403 | $800 | $2,419 |
Town Of Tonawanda 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,658 | $880 | $3,990 |
Town Of Tonawanda 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,625 | $969 | $3,500 |
Town Of Tonawanda 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,523 | $844 | $4,100 |
